I don't know if you've made a decision yet, but I'm a big fan of magnaflow. They might be a bit more spendy, but they are stainless steel and won't rust out like some of the flowmasters. Also, unlikethe flowmaster chambered design (sorry FM guys not bashingyour mufflers,I justREALLY like mine)magnaflow and borla-another good performance muffler- area straight through design thatflow really well. I've had mine for 2 years now and haven't had a single person tell me it was loud or obnoxious, and I've had everyone from myfriends to my grandma riding with me. well so far everyone likes the flowmasters and magnaflows. but if you want your truck to be louder and meaner than that fastback stang, i guarantee you, if anything will do it its gonna be a glass pack. cheap, loud, and a big head turner. a friend of mine has a cherry bomb glasspack on his chevy 1500 with the 305 V8 in it. multiple times people have asked him what size engine is in cause it sounds so loud and powerful. it is loud outside the truck and you can hear it coming from about a quarter mile away if there is nothing blockin the sound like buildings. but from the interior of the truck its not too loud, so your able to still carry on a conversation without yellin on the phone or with passengers or you can still listen to the radio without blowing all your speakers. cherry bomb glasspacks run from 30 bucks up to 45 bucks from jegs.com. thrush glasspacks are a little cheaper, but from what i've heard, they dont have the same rumble to them. if they were legal i would tell you to run flowtech purple hornies glasspack header mufflers, but with no cat, and no pipe at all, they are just way too loud to be legal.
